#6b4988 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b4988 is composed of 42% red, 28.6%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 272.4 degrees, a saturation of 30.1% and a lightness of 41%. #6b4988 color hex could be obtained by blending #d692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#6b4988 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#6b4988 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b4988 has RGB values of R:107, G:73,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 7031176.
